Hello,

 

I have now the dimension as default on the layer "MATEN". But we change it in our template to "_XXXXX_MATEN".

But it looks like it does not accept this new layer when I try to change it with the command DIMLAYER.

 

Anyone knows if the _ is a problem for assigning dimensions as a layer?

I have no problems using DIMLAYER command to assign layer _XXXXX_MATEN

Even when that layer does not exist I'm still able to enter that as the layer name.

Then on the next dimension I draw it automatically creates that layer and places the DIMENSION there.

But any DIMENSIONS you already have in your drawing prior to DIMLAYER command will not change.

I think I found my problem.

 

I used the " " in the new name. But then typed it without it and it worked fine.
